PUF5GI / UF504IG ULTRAFAST RECOVERY RECTIFIERS Voltage 400 V Current 5A Features  Silicon epitaxial high-speed diodes  Soft recovery characteristics  Low forward voltage, high current capability  Hermetically sealed.
 Low leakage  High surge capacity  Lead free in compliance with EU RoHS 2011/65/EU directive  Green molding compound as per IEC61249 Std.
